Frequently Asked Questions about the 94158 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 94158?

There are currently 32 Studio Apartments in 94158 with rent ranges from $1,078 to $10,000 with an average price of $4,381.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 94158 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 94158 ranges from $3,889 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,110.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 94158 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 94158 range from $5,197 to $12,047.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$6,260.
